A boy recalls the relation for relativistic mass (m) in terms of rest mass (m_(0)) velocity of particle V, but forgets to put the constant c (velocity of light). He writes m=(m_(0))/((1-v^(2))^(1//2)) correct the equation by putting themissing ‘c’. |
|
Answer» Solution :SINCE quantities of similar nature can only be ADDED or subtracted, `v^(2)` cannot be subtracted from 1 but `v^(2)//C^(2)` can be subtracted from 1. `therefore m=(m_(@))/(SQRT(1-v^(2)//c^(2)))` |
